Asheville Greenworks hosts Root Ball tonight on French Broad River

From Asheville Greenworks:

Join Asheville Greenworks as we host the second annual “Root Ball”, a fundraising event to allow us to continue working for a “clean & green” environment. The party will be held Thursday September 18th, 2014, from 6:30-9:30pm at the “Boathouse” by the French Broad River at 318 Riverside Drive. 
All you care to eat, drink and dance. 

The event will be end to summer ball with a nod to GreenWorks’ passion for getting dirty for a great cause, so sundresses, shorts and sandals. 

Tickets are $25 in advance and $30 at the door.

Parking is limited, so we will be running shuttles from our auxiliary parking lot to the party. Shuttles will be running every ten minutes throughout the entire evening.

Parking address:
172 Riverside Drive, Asheville NC 28801
